Geographical Location
Dharmapuri is situated at an elevation of 450 meters above sea level. It is surrounded by the Eastern Ghats, which influence its climate and weather patterns. The city is located approximately 300 kilometers southwest of Chennai, the capital city of Tamil Nadu.
Climate Classification
Dharmapuri falls under the tropical savanna climate classification (Aw) according to the Köppen-Geiger climate classification system. The city experiences hot and dry summers, followed by a monsoon season and mild winters.
Seasons
Dharmapuri has three distinct seasons: summer, monsoon, and winter.
Summer (March to May)
Summer in Dharmapuri is characterized by scorching heat and high temperatures. The average maximum temperature during this season ranges from 35°C to 40°C (95°F to 104°F), while the minimum temperature hovers around 25°C (77°F). The city experiences low humidity levels and clear blue skies.
Monsoon (June to September)
The monsoon season in Dharmapuri brings relief from the summer heat. The city receives moderate to heavy rainfall during this period, with an average precipitation of around 800 mm. The temperatures during the monsoon season range between 25°C and 30°C (77°F and 86°F). The rain showers bring a lush green cover to the city, making it a picturesque sight.
Winter (October to February)
Winter in Dharmapuri is mild and pleasant, making it the best time to visit the city. The average maximum temperature during this season ranges from 28°C to 32°C (82°F to 90°F), while the minimum temperature drops to around 18°C (64°F). The weather remains dry and comfortable, attracting tourists from different parts of the country.
Annual Weather Averages
Here is a table showcasing the annual weather averages for Dharmapuri:
Month | Max Temperature (°C) | Min Temperature (°C) | Precipitation (mm) |
---|---|---|---|
January | 29 | 18 | 3 |
February | 31 | 19 | 6 |
March | 34 | 22 | 10 |
April | 37 | 25 | 28 |
May | 38 | 27 | 63 |
June | 36 | 25 | 78 |
July | 34 | 23 | 67 |
August | 33 | 22 | 70 |
September | 33 | 22 | 118 |
October | 32 | 22 | 185 |
November | 29 | 20 | 174 |
December | 28 | 19 | 55 |
Source: World Weather Online
